Quick-turn manufacturers optimize their production lines for pace. They have staff and equipment dedicated to expedited orders, along with robust inventory management systems that ensure essential materials are always available. They also prioritize designs that use readily-available materials, which can save on both design and production costs. In addition, they may limit the number of layers on a board or its complexity to reduce the overall cost of production.
A critical component of quick-turn PCB fabrication is the streamlined testing protocol that ensures all components are functioning properly and correctly in the final product. This includes tests at the circuit level, such as shorts and opens, as well as functional testing, which simulates a PCB’s operating environment to identify any problems that could affect performance.

In the world of quick-turn PCB fabrication, prototyping is the key to keeping projects on schedule. Prototypes allow engineers and designers to test their ideas with a real-world device before committing to the expense of full-scale production. This helps to minimize errors, speed up the production process and prevent costly missteps in the final product.

Quick Turn PCBs refer to the fast production of PCBs, often completed within a few days, compared to traditional PCB manufacturing timelines that can take weeks. These boards are critical in prototyping, product development, and industries where speed is crucial, such as telecommunications, aerospace, automotive, and medical devices.
